#313709 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#313709 is composed of 19.2% red, 21.6%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.6% yellow and 78.4% black. It has a hue angle of 67.8 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 12.5%. #313709 color hex could be obtained by blending #626e12 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#313709 color description : Very dark yellow [Olive tone].
The hexadecimal color #313709 has RGB values of R:49, G:55,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.84,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 3225353.
